Dildos VS Vibrators, What’s the Difference Between Them?

It is not uncommon that today, the terms ‘dildo’ and ‘vibrator’ are used interchangeably,’ so much so that they are often used. The two are, however, very different. There are many vibrators that look like dildos, but one major difference is, as you might expect, that dildos do not have a vibrating feature. In order to clarify this, let’s look at it in more detail.

Dildos – What Are They?

There are some dildos that are cast from the genitals of male porn actors, which makes them look like a penis (fun fact: many dildos are often shaped and molded to look like a penis). A jelly dildo, silicone dildo, plastic dildo, or glass dildo is usually made of jelly, silicone, plastic, or glass material.

In addition to their colors, they also come in different shapes (straight or curved), sizes (lengths and thicknesses), textures (smooth or veiny), and densities (hard or soft). Although there is no vibration in Dildos, they are intended for penetration. Both women and men may use them.

What is a Vibrator?

The vibrator, on the other hand, vibrates! The color, shape, size, texture, and density of vibrators are all similar to those of dildos. Vibrators, however, provide an almost endless range of possibilities.

Vibrators: Types and Applications

There might be a lot to choose from when it comes to vibrators, but we explain everything here. While external models are designed for clitoral stimulation, g-spot vibrators are designed for internal use. They target those hard-to-reach erogenous zones.

Vibrating rabbits offer both internal and external stimulation using a wand you insert and vibrating rabbit ears to tickle your clit. You will experience a mind-blowing orgasm as a result of the double pulsation.

Cost comparison between Dildo and Vibrator

Dildos and vibrators are really similar when it comes to price, but you should compare their features. It’s one thing to have a basic model and something else to have models with a host of features that will drive you right over the edge.

In comparison with silicone and glass dildos, plastic dildos are cheaper. It is also considerably cheaper to buy a vibrator with three intensity levels, as opposed to one with Bluetooth capabilities and an app for control.

With the exception of vibrating models and ones that squirt fluids of your choice, dildos are generally cheaper in general because they don’t traditionally involve mechanisms.

Storage and cleaning of Dildo versus Vibrator

There is essentially no difference in the way to care for a dildo or vibrator. Keep the toy in a cool, dry place and clean it off before storing.

If you want to keep them from collecting dust between uses, you can buy special boxes or bags. Some come with cases, or you can buy specialty boxes and bags.
